June 6-10

This week the class completed its focused study on geography, and with  
that, the geography book we have used. The groups wrapped up with a  
focus on Line Graphs and Timelines, completing In-Class #3 on these  
two topics.

The group then transitioned to a study of individual countries, as  
highlighted in the books that many had been eager to finally use. The  
months of geography study will be useful in the focus on several  
countries, to include Brazil, China, and Kenya.

Before leaping in the teacher introduced the book, reviewing the table  
of contents and noting that the countries to be studies were  
"representative" of others in their given region. Students defined in  
their notebooks "representative," "climate" (learning the four main  
types and how they impact how we live), and "culture" (essentially,  
everything we do that goes beyond our shared necessities for  
survival). Finally, the teacher promised students that they would be  
doing a lot of writing, and tasked them to write a paragraph on "what  
makes Costa Rica special" before they began learning about what makes  
other countries the same.
